Frequently Asked Questions

Q

I am disabled. Can I still use the pool?

A

The Timpany Center is an all-accessible facility that is open to all ages and all abilities.
  

Q

I am not disabled. Can I still use the pool?

A

Yes, the Timpany Center is open to all ages and all abilities.
  

Q

Can I have an attendant in the water with me?

A

Yes, attendants are allowed in the water. An attendant must stay within arm's reach of you, and must also pay the attendant fee.
  

Q

I would like someone to help me in the water. Can you set me up with an attendant?

A

Because the Timpany Center is classified as a learning institution through San Jose State University, there are many students who need hands-on experience working with individuals. We can try to set you up with a student to assist you at the Timpany Center, but this is always based on the students' availability. Please speak with the manager on duty for more information.
  

Q

Does the Timpany Center accept insurance?

A

No, the Timpany Center does not take insurance.
  

Q

Does the Timpany Center take my Worker's Compensation Claim?

A

The process of dealing with Worker's Compensation companies can be difficult. It is usually best if you to pay the monthly membership fees; the Timpany Center will write you a receipt to present to your Worker's Compensation for reimbursement. However, in the event that you cannot pay the monthly membership fee up-front, the Timpany Center will provide you with a form to fill out listing any Worker's Compensation information.
